partypoker Signs Tennis Legend Boris Becker!

Boris Becker, a former tennis world number one, is partypoker's newest Ambassador! To celebrate, partypoker is launching a special tennis-themed promotion, starting on 5th December, giving players the chance to play in four $5,000 freerolls with the overall winner playing Boris live, heads up in Germany for up to $25,000!
